A DELIVERY driver was pistol- whipped and robbed of cash and several packages after a man posing as a customer lured him to a delivery address in Pleasantville, San Fernando on Saturday afternoon.According to police reports, the driver, employed with the 'O Deliver' company, was driving to a location along the corner of Flamingo and Ibis Drive, Pleasantville to deliver a package for a customer named 'Kemani' with whom he was in communication via cell phone.The driver told the police that when he saw the 'customer' approaching, he parked the vehicle. The driver said that when the 'customer' approached him and requested to see his package, he became suspicious and stated the price of it.The 'customer' then pointed a firearm at the driver, and the two began to scuffle. The driver reported that he was struck several times on his face and upper body with the firearm, and during the scuffle, an unloaded magazine ejected from the firearm and fell on the ground near the driver's door.The driver said a second man then approached the delivery van and the armed suspect then demanded, 'Give me everything'. The suspects robbed the driver of approximately $5,000 cash before the accomplice opened the door of the delivery van and removed several packages from inside.The two suspects then fled the scene with the stolen cash and packages by running into Flamingo Drive.The driver contacted the police, and officers of the Mon Repos CID responded and recovered the empty firearm magazine on the road.PC Elliott of the Mon Repos Police Station is continuing investigations.
